Transaction 63c3442b93758fbbf6645f2f2fc4265450142a342812c23d1bd2fb1c0a1fb81e

2 Input
2 Outputs
  • 63c3442b93758fbbf6645f2f2fc4265450142a342812c23d1bd2fb1c0a1fb81e:0
  • value  23838528
    address  1DBhzFQXX4J1ti6U45yfJqtD7WrrRYWTEN
  • 63c3442b93758fbbf6645f2f2fc4265450142a342812c23d1bd2fb1c0a1fb81e:1
  • value  172404
    address  bc1qma53587kasasfchkyjz25pzcsu4ej2mn9dj0xv